Safe infectious disease transport

Air ambulances can transport patients with infectious diseases, provided strict medical and operational protocols are followed.

Transporting a patient with an infectious disease requires more than standard in-flight medical care. Air ambulances follow strict guidelines to ensure safety for the patient, crew, and destination facilities. This includes risk assessment, containment strategies, and coordination with airport and health authorities.

Diseases ranging from multidrug-resistant infections to airborne viruses may require isolation units and specially trained medical staff. Each case is evaluated individually to determine the safest method of transport.

Conditions where specialist infectious transport is needed

  • Airborne infectious diseases (e.g. tuberculosis)
  • Highly contagious viral infections
  • Patients requiring full isolation
  • Cases with elevated transmission risk
  • International transfers requiring medical containment

Isolation and protection measures

Containment systems and protective equipment are crucial during infectious disease flights.

Core infection control procedures

1

Use of transport isolation units

Portable isolation chambers prevent airborne and contact transmission.

2

Full PPE for crew

Medical staff use certified masks, gowns, gloves, and eye protection.

3

Decontamination of aircraft

Certified disinfectants are used after each mission.

4

Patient stabilization

Reducing contamination risk before boarding.

Specialized aircraft and equipment

Dedicated medical jets are equipped to safely handle infectious disease transfers.

Key aircraft features

  • Negative pressure isolation units
  • Filtered ventilation systems
  • Dedicated infectious disease medical kits
  • On-board laboratory diagnostics
  • Advanced life-support monitoring

The combination of advanced isolation systems and medical-grade environmental controls ensures that infectious disease transport is safe. Crews are trained specifically for biohazard management and inflight infection control.

International rules and approvals

Global infectious disease transport requires coordination with aviation, border control, and public health authorities.

Cross-border transport of infectious patients is subject to strict regulations defined by WHO, ICAO, IATA, and national health authorities. Operators must secure overflight permissions, landing clearances, and medical transport approvals. Clear communication with destination hospitals ensures safe handover upon arrival.

Key regulatory considerations

  • National infectious disease control laws
  • WHO guidelines for medical evacuation
  • Aviation authority compliance
  • Airport quarantine procedures
  • International health documentation requirements

Preparation and documentation

Proper documentation prevents delays in the approval process.

Checklist

1

Medical summary

Diagnosis, infectious risk, and recent clinical updates.

2

Laboratory results

Including tests confirming infection type and status.

3

Isolation requirements

Details needed for aircraft preparation.

4

Travel documents

Passports, visas, and health declarations.

5

Receiving hospital confirmation

Required before international transport.
